2 definitions by stephen Crow

That which leeches out early on and helps to lubricate the coming insertion.
'I grabbed your organ and got cockleech all over my new watchband!
by stephen Crow May 18, 2003
A collosal great big erection....or any other larger object
'Weezer, will you see that zambonious sized truck out there on the thin ice!"
by stephen Crow May 18, 2003
